Commit creates solution that aims to revolutionize the process for hiring tech staff

Driving the future of tech R&D, Commit, a global tech services company focused on custom software and IoT solutions, is introducing a new staffing solution, Cloud of People, to address critical challenges companies face when hiring engineers and tech specialists today.

“Tech recruiting has never been more difficult. The gap between supply and demand is growing rapidly, and the rising costs for tech experts have never been higher. This places tremendous pressure on businesses, and particularly startups, who have limited funding and time to get products to market,” said Max Nirenberg CRO and managing director, Commit USA. “Cloud of People is the perfect solution to not only tackle these challenges, but also capitalize on emerging trends to forge a new path forward.”   

Commit’s Cloud of People addresses emerging challenges and more by breaking down legacy approaches to hiring, while streamlining HR processes to quickly form new teams and mitigate risk, according to the vendor. 

By deploying the Cloud of People model, Commit’s clients can onboard dedicated teams of senior, highly skilled software developers and tech experts within just two weeks.

With more than 600 multi-disciplinary experts from around the world, Commit can supply the best engineering talent for any project or role. 

Commit makes staffing hassle-free by managing the entire team-building process—screening, interviewing, and recruiting top-talent—all with no risk to its clients. 

To date, Commit has led nearly 1,200 software development projects for more than 1,000 organizations around the world.

Its customers range from early-stage startups to international brands including IBM, Citi, JFrog and many others. Since Commit’s expansion into North America earlier this year, the company has increased its client base in the region by six times, according to the company.
